使用入门的前提条件
硬件 开始使用爱特梅尔SAMA5D3 Xplained工具包之前,需要以下几项: Windows XP(或更高版本)或Linux发行版 Micro-AB转A型的USB设备电缆 爱特梅尔SAMA5D3 Xplained开发板 可选USB转串行DBGU端口工具,例如,FTDI的TTL-232R-3V3 USB转TTL串口线
SAMA5D3 Xplained概览
串行终端仿真程序 要访问Linux控制台,需要一个串行终端仿真器,例如HyperTerminal、minicom、PuTTY、 picocom、screen等。标准的串行通讯参数是115200 N-8-1。
访问Linux控制台 Linux控制台通过SAMA5D36器件的USB设备端口(也被称为“USB小工具”)访问。将USB Micor-AB线缆从接口(J6)连接到计算机上空闲的USB端口,并且使用USB-CDC接口。
Linux用户 一旦主板通电后,建立起与主机的连接时,请按照下列步骤操作: 1. 通过监测dmesg命令的最后几行确认USB连接。/dev/ ttyACMx端口号会用于配置串行终端仿真程序。 使用CDC驱动程序,你可以看到一个/ dev / ttyACM0节点已在你的主机系统上创建。 - $ dmesg
- [..]
- [73507.188239] usb 1-1.1.1: new high-speed USB device number 49 using ehci-pci
- [73507.281410] usb 1-1.1.1: New USB device found, idVendor=0525, idProduct=a4a7
- [73507.281418] usb 1-1.1.1: New USB device strings: Mfr=1, Product=2,
- SerialNumber=0
- [73507.281421] usb 1-1.1.1: Product: Gadget Serial v2.4
- [73507.281422] usb 1-1.1.1: Manufacturer: Linux 3.10.0-yocto-standard with
- atmel_usba_udc
- [73507.287341] cdc_acm 1-1.1.1:2.0: This device cannot do calls on its own. It
- is not a modem.
- [73507.287377] cdc_acm 1-1.1.1:2.0: ttyACM0: USB ACM device
复制代码
2. 运行串行终端仿真程序,并使用115200 8-N-1的参数。 - $ picocom -b 115200 /dev/ttyACM0
- picocom v1.7
- port is : /dev/ttyACM0
- flowcontrol : none
- baudrate is : 115200
- parity is : none
- databits are : 8
- escape is : C-a
- local echo is : no
- noinit is : no
- noreset is : no
- nolock is : no
- send_cmd is : sz -vv
- receive_cmd is : rz -vv
- imap is :
- omap is :
- emap is : crcrlf,delbs,
复制代码
终端准备就绪。 3. 使用root登陆账户连接开发板。不需要密码。 - Poky (Yocto Project Reference Distro) 1.5.1 SAMA5D3 Xplained /dev/ttyGS0
- SAMA5D3 Xplained login: root
- root@SAMA5D3 Xplained:~#
复制代码
4. 您现在可以使用主板上的Linux系统了。
Windows用户 主板上电,并且建立起与主机的连接后,Windows系统请求对应于SAMA5D3 Xplained电路板的USB CDC设备的驱动程序。然后按照下面的步骤: 1. 下载配置USB-CDC驱动程序所需的官方.inf文件:www.kernel.org/doc/Documentation/usb/linux-cdc-acm.inf 2. 确保文件正确保存为一个.inf文件。不要使用.TXT扩展名。 3. 单击“开始菜单”,并打开“控制面板”。在“控制面板”中点击“系统”。显示系统窗口后,打开“设备管理器”。 4. 在其他设备查找,应该可以看到一个名为“Gadget Serial V2.4”的端口。 设备管理器窗口
在“Gadget Serial V2.4”设备上右击,选择“更新驱动程序软件...”选项。 6. 选择“浏览我的驱动程序软件的计算机”选项安装串行驱动程序。 7. Windows可能会提示您确认安装驱动程序。如果是这样,接受安装。使用官方小工具串行.inf文件(见步骤1)可确保驱动程序软件的完整性。 8. 驱动程序安装完成后,系统会显示消息:“Windows已经成功安装了驱动程序”。 9. 在Windows主机系统,确定建立了USB连接:端口应该出现在Windows设备管理器。该COMxx号用于配置串行终端仿真程序。
10.使用表7-1指定的参数和COMxx端口号运行串行终端仿真程序。 11.现在,您可以使用root登陆账户连接开发板。不需要密码。 - Poky (Yocto Project Reference Distro) 1.5.1 SAMA5D3 Xplained /dev/ttyGS0
- SAMA5D3 Xplained login: root
- root@SAMA5D3 Xplained:~#
复制代码
12. 您现在可以使用主板上的Linux系统了。。
|